Vidya Wires Limited has submitted a certificate under Regulation 74(5) of the SEBI (Depositories and Participants) Regulations, 2018. This certificate was issued by MUFG Intime India Private Limited, the company's Registrar and Share Transfer Agent.
The certificate pertains to the quarter ended December 31, 2025. It confirms that the dematerialization of securities received from depository participants during this period has been processed and confirmed with the depositories. The Registrar and Share Transfer Agent also confirmed that the relevant security certificates were mutilated and cancelled after verification, with the depositories' names substituted in the register of members within the prescribed timelines.
